One of the most brutally honest slabs on the Chilean coast, Intendencia is a heavy left that detonates over a submerged reef just north of Playa Cavancha in Iquique. It demands a full S to SW swell, 3ft to 12ft, with easterly offshores and a high tide to keep the reef covered enough to make the drop survivable. Below full tide, the wave goes square and beyond vertical, turning the takeoff into something close to unmakeable for anyone but the most committed bodyboarders and expert stand-ups. The crowd is small by necessity: only the local crew who know this wave intimately show up when it's on. Bottom: submerged reef. Season: autumn and winter swells. Consistency: medium. The wave consistently looks smaller from the road than it actually is, so add at least a foot to your visual read before paddling out.

Crowd & Localism

Weekend crowds rarely exceed a handful of surfers, and most casual surfers self-select out once they see the wave in action. The local bodyboard crew have this break thoroughly dialled and will be the most capable people in the water on any significant swell. Respect that hierarchy, watch from the road first, and do not paddle out on your first visit without understanding the exit.

Access & Facilities

No dedicated parking and no facilities on site. The break sits north of Playa Cavancha, accessible from the Iquique coastal road. Water quality is rated residential-level pollution, so post-surf hygiene matters. The reef itself is the primary hazard: shallow, uneven, and unforgiving on a wipeout. Do not surf alone.

Nearby Alternatives

When Intendencia is too heavy or the tide is wrong, Playa Cavancha offers a more forgiving city beach option in winter and on wind swell. Colegio, Iquique's most consistent performance wave, is close by and handles a wider range of conditions and skill levels.
